The story of “Cristal Moon” begins in Italy in the year 2001—a transitional period for dance music where the raw energy of late-90s rave was maturing into more refined, yet still powerful, house and techno sounds. The track was released as a 12-inch vinyl single by the mysterious artist . The release was a promotional (Promo) pressing under the catalog number NL 037 .

The rhythm section forms the backbone. Instead of rigid, robotic four-on-the-floor techno beats, this style leans into organic percussion. Expect syncopated congas, bongos, shakers, and woodblocks layered over electronic elements. These polyrhythms create a rolling, hypnotic groove that keeps the body moving instinctively. 2.
